In week 4 of their internship, the author formed relationships with students in their class and had individual conversations to get to know each student better. They set up their teaching schedule but struggled to discipline students because the relationships made students try to talk back or ignore instructions. The author had to stand close and speak firmly to give directions. They also had trouble staying engaged all day during observations and their throat hurt, but drinking more water helped.
